Just so you know what you're getting, many people who buy the package are under the impression that the "Fantasmic! Dessert & VIP Viewing Experience" is a party. Unlike the dessert parties at MK, Epcot and DHS, there isn't a separate party area with tables and F&B stations. At about half the price of those dessert parties, for $39/$19, Guests get a snack box with the following:
One bottle of water
One specialty beverage (alcoholic or non-alcoholic)
Reserved seating area for Fantasmic!
Custom credential with light-up medallion
Light-up novelty cup

They are then directed to the reserved seating area.

Dessert Parties are paid in full in advance. They can be canceled in advance...at least 48 hours, I believe.

Dining Package is paid at the time of the meal - many use Dining Plan credits.
